Garden upkeep is an necessary practice for keeping outdoor areas healthy, lively, and inviting throughout the year. A well-maintained garden not only enhances a residential or commercial property's visual appeal but likewise ensures the longevity of its plants and functions. Maintenance includes regular tasks such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By addressing these requirements regularly, gardeners can avoid insect invasions, control disease spread, and maintain a balanced environment where plants prosper. Seasonal considerations, such as mulching in the spring or safeguarding fragile plants in winter season, are also crucial to sustaining garden vigor. Beyond visual appeals, appropriate garden upkeep contributes in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Getting rid of infected or broken foliage assists avoid pathogens from dispersing, while strategic pruning encourages new growth and blooming.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and raw material replenishment-- provides the nutrients plants need to flourish. Furthermore, the thoughtful combination of buddy planting and pollinator-friendly species can enhance garden strength while adding to regional ecosystems. A structured upkeep schedule helps house owners prepare for continuous needs and avoid pricey overhauls later on. This schedule typically consists of regular monthly inspections,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as required. Whether for decorative flower beds, vegetable plots, or mixed-use landscapes, constant care guarantees that the garden stays a source of satisfaction and beauty all year long
